74 int
75 pcap_stats(pcap_t *p, struct pcap_stat *ps)
76 {
77
78 /*
79 * "ps_recv" counts packets handed to the filter, not packets
80 * that passed the filter. As filtering is done in userland,
81 * this does not include packets dropped because we ran out
82 * of buffer space.
83 *
84 * "ps_drop" presumably counts packets dropped by the socket
85 * because of flow control requirements or resource exhaustion;
86 * it doesn't count packets dropped by the interface driver.
87 * As filtering is done in userland, it counts packets regardless
88 * of whether they would've passed the filter.
89 *
90 * These statistics don't include packets not yet read from the
91 * kernel by libpcap or packets not yet read from libpcap by the
92 * application.
93 */
94 *ps = p->md.stat;
95 return (0);
96 }
